Output 44c08de54cabd55cfddb3a7ce98002b4060c0b0ca5e7ed49ce25199632a28d61:0

value
21530773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bdbf20abfc846aaaf070ea8d6d4d938a7f686a OP_EQUAL
address
34388ATXT8n6JXHBaMmbQGs9QtK3Hohf5x
transaction
44c08de54cabd55cfddb3a7ce98002b4060c0b0ca5e7ed49ce25199632a28d61
spent
true